繁体   English   中英

Google Colab 错误:导入“tensorflow.keras.models”无法解决(reportMissingImports)

[英]Google Colab error: Import "tensorflow.keras.models" could not be resolved(reportMissingImports)

import tensorflow as tf
tf.__version__

!sudo pip3 install keras

from tensorflow.keras.models import Sequential
from tensorflow.keras.layers import Dense, Conv2D, Flatten, Dropout, MaxPooling2D
from tensorflow.keras.preprocessing.image import ImageDataGenerator

错误信息:

Import "tensorflow.keras.models" could not be resolved(reportMissingImports)
>Import "tensorflow.keras.layers" could not be resolved(reportMissingImports)
>>Import "tensorflow.keras.preprocessing.image" could not be resolved(reportMissingImports)
import tensorflow as tf
tf.__version__

!sudo pip3 install keras

from tensorflow.python.keras.engine.sequential import Sequential

from tensorflow.python.keras.layers import Dense, Conv2D, Flatten, Dropout, MaxPooling2D

image_data_generator = tf.keras.preprocessing.image.ImageDataGenerator()

我有同样的错误,我做了这些步骤步骤 01 :用这个指令卸载现有的 tensorflow

!pip uninstall tensorflow

步骤 02:安装此版本我希望您通过此说明在此版本中找到您需要的内容

!pip install tensorflow==2.7.0

如果 2.7.0 不适合您的代码,您可以更改 tensorflow 的版本

问题解决了。

虽然报错: Import "tensorflow.keras.models" could not be resolved(reportMissingImports) ,但不影响整个代码。 我的 Tensorflow 版本是 2.8.0。 我刚刚发现问题出在我的 cnn model 的配置上。

我解决了。

问题是我的版本太新了。 您只需降低 TensorFlow 版本,使其适合您的要求。 我使用pip install tensorflow==2.7.0.

检查这些图像,警告线对我来说消失了。

在我降级我的 TensorFlow 版本之前

在我降级我的 TensorFlow 版本之后

这对我有用。

'从 tensorflow 导入 keras

从 keras.layers 导入密集

从 keras.models 导入顺序,load_model'

暂无
暂无

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M